About the Role

We are looking for a virtual Child & Adolescent Therapist to join reputed company to deliver family-centric and evidence-based care. This is a fully remote position. Responsibilities:

  • Provide evidence-based individual and group treatment to patients and families
  • Use measurement-based care to inform treatment planning
  • Collaborate with other care team members (e.g., coach and psychiatrist)
  • Provide feedback on program curricula and training protocols
  • Provide feedback regarding the various applications of technology in treatment
  • Maintain awareness of risk management issues
  • Complete documentation in a timely and thorough manner
  • Participate in initial and ongoing trainings on the application of evidence-based and tech-enhanced care delivery
  • Facilitate skills or skills practice groups, as assigned. These age-based groups, for patients or parents/caregivers, focus on skills development and implementation based on the reputed company curriculum. These groups are based in reputed company, and integrate aspects of ACT and PMT

What You Need to Succeed in the Role

  • Ph.D. or PsyD. in psychology from an accredited school of psychology, LICSW from an accredited school of social work, or CHMC & Masters degree from an accredited graduate program
  • New Hampshire licensure appropriate to clinical discipline
  • Strong background in treating children and adolescents with anxiety and reputed company disorders
  • Experience and training in delivering evidence-based treatments (e.g., reputed company, ACT, DBT)
  • Basic computer skills, facility with and openness to new technologies
  • Excellent written and interpersonal communication skills
  • Ability to be flexible and nimble and work well both independently and as part of a team in a fast-paced, mission driven environment
  • Culturally reputed company with regard to diversity and inclusion
  • Ability to handle sensitive and confidential information in a manner that inspires confidence and trust

The expected annual salary for this role is between $80,000-100,000. Actual starting salary will be determined on an individualized basis and will be based on several factors including but not limited to specific reputed company set, work experience, licensure, etc. Additional compensation may be considered based on factors such as licensure type, appropriate state licensure, prime time hour availability, and more.
